Making Fuzzing Part of Your Software Development Lifecycle

Overview
Explore the world of fuzzing in software development through this informative conference talk. Learn about this powerful automated vulnerability and bug-finding technique that has gained significant popularity in recent years. Discover essential tools and techniques used to secure hundreds of open source projects, including libFuzzer, AFL++, ClusterFuzz, and ClusterFuzzLite. Gain insights into OSS-Fuzz, a free service that has uncovered 40,000 bugs in critical open source projects, and Syzkaller and Syzbot for kernel fuzzing. Understand the evolution of fuzzing from early days to modern unittest-style approaches, and learn about sanitizers, non-C++ bugs, and coverage reports. Get practical advice on implementing a ClusterFuzz-style workflow, running full-scale infrastructure, and integrating fuzzing into your build process. By the end of this 39-minute talk, acquire the knowledge needed to enhance the security of your applications and dependencies using this essential testing technique.
